Will I be charged customs or import tax?

Whether you are charged money at the border depends on the destination country. When applied, this charge is for the sales tax for that country but is often referred to as customs charges, customs fees, import charges, duty, duty fees, import tax, import fees.

  • Orders being shipped to the United States, the EU and the UK will not be charged at the border.
  • To the other countries of the world it depends on the value of the shipment. Over a certain value you will be charged the sales tax of that country. You can view those minimum values by clicking this link.

How do you maintain a carbon-neutral approach to printing and shipping?

I collaborate with The Print Space, a reputable and carbon-neutral art printing service. Their commitment to sustainability ensures that your chosen prints are produced with the environment in mind, minimizing the ecological footprint.

The Print Space follows a carbon offset program, which involves calculating the carbon emissions generated during the production process. They then invest in certified environmental projects that offset these emissions, making each print carbon-neutral.
